Transaction 415590bb5050a70ee4e047f773fde2143641577ee4f9ec753eb640c4110021a6
1 Input
1 Output
-
415590bb5050a70ee4e047f773fde2143641577ee4f9ec753eb640c4110021a6:0
- value
- 18190000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b8f882004216e24e38be0e3b836bbf61ca76b1f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AojFHai1h2VMsodE7p2gKKoip5SDihhay